I am intrigued by his surname Huline-Dickens. His grandfather completed the 1911 census using just Huline, no mention of Dickens but his great grandfather used Huline Dickens, not double barrelled. They were consistently Dickens before that. The obits refer to links to the circus family of Huline, but I can't see any such link. I wondered if it was the Huline family wanting to connect to the famous Dickens, rather than the other way round.
